Victoria Pinõn Jacquez

Victoria Pinõn Jacquez was born December 23, 1940, in Agua Blanca, Sonora, Mexico, to Feliciano and Maria Amendarez Pinõn. Victoria was one of six children.

Vito and her family relocated to Safford, Arizona, in 1969. She enjoyed sewing, cooking, and spending time with her family and friends. Vito was very active in the Kingdom Hall of Jehovah Witnesses.

Vito’s passing came on January 29, 2024, in her son’s home in Mesa, Arizona. She was 83. She was kind, strong, independent and she loved her family unconditionally. Above all Jehovah came first.

Vito is survived by: her six girls, Elizabeth, Ramona, Nora, Gloria, Lorraine, and Sandra; and her three boys, Adrian, Julian, and Andres.

She was predeceased by: one daughter, Maria Olga Ruiz; and one son, Pedro P. Jacquez.
